War typically involves organized, large-scale conflict between nations or states, often characterized by formal armies and established political objectives. In contrast, rebellion refers to an uprising against an existing authority or government, usually by a group within a society seeking to change or overthrow the current system. While wars can encompass multiple rebellions, rebellions are often more localized and can occur within the context of a larger war. Ultimately, the key difference lies in the scale, participants, and objectives of the conflict.

Tennessee is bordered by North Carolina to the east. It also is bordered by Kentucky and Virginia to the north, Georgia, Alabama, and Mississippi to the south, and Arkansas and Missouri to the west.

The two states located between Georgia and Virginia that also border the Atlantic Ocean are South Carolina and North Carolina. South Carolina lies directly south of North Carolina, and both states have coastlines along the Atlantic. This positioning places them between Georgia to the south and Virginia to the north.
No, Lake Superior is not in Georgia; it is located in North America, primarily bordered by the United States and Canada. It is the largest of the Great Lakes and lies between the states of Minnesota, Wisconsin, and Michigan, as well as the Canadian province of Ontario. Georgia is situated in the southeastern United States, far from Lake Superior.
